Investment Rating - The report rates the leisure services industry as "Positive" as of December 25, 2024 [19]. Core Insights - The macro consumption data shows a continuous recovery, with November retail sales growing by 3.0% year-on-year, supported by policy subsidies that have created significant consumer stickiness [19][29]. - The Central Economic Work Conference emphasized the importance of expanding domestic demand, indicating that consumption and investment will be combined to enhance investment efficiency and stimulate economic growth [27][28]. - The travel market is experiencing an overall recovery driven by long-term policies, with a notable increase in public travel and tourism activities [19][29]. - Duty-free shopping in Hainan is showing signs of gradual recovery, with expectations for a stable upward trend in the future [19][29]. Monthly Macro Consumption Summary - November retail sales reached 43,763 billion yuan, with a year-on-year increase of 3.0%. The retail sales of goods amounted to 37,951 billion yuan, up 2.8%, while catering revenue was 5,802 billion yuan, up 4.0% [29][33]. - The cumulative retail sales for January to November 2024 totaled 44.27 trillion yuan, reflecting a year-on-year growth of 3.5% [29]. - The retail sales of essential goods, such as food and daily necessities, continued to show strong growth, with food and oil products increasing by 10.1% and 1.3% year-on-year, respectively [50]. Industry Insights - The report highlights that the issuance of new consumption vouchers has significantly boosted the catering sector, with November catering revenue reaching its highest level since March [33]. - The consumer electronics and home appliance sectors are experiencing robust growth, driven by the "old-for-new" subsidy policies, which have created consumer stickiness [51]. - The real estate market is showing signs of recovery, with new housing sales increasing by 10.2% in terms of area and 6.8% in terms of sales value year-on-year in November [35].
